The Space Coast (the area in Florida between the Kennedy Space Center and Cape Canaveral) has always been progressive and advanced in terms of tech, innovation, and discovery. It has, however, in recent times somewhat stagnated as the industry related to NASA and space exploration has moved on, and private space tech firms have taken over the sector.

Yes, there has been some re-growth and development as companies pivot to assist and work for private space launches, but it’s just not been enough to reinvigorate the local economy to pre-2011 when NASA stopped launches.

There are, however, still some great institutions of learning and knowledge creation in the region, as well as the political will to make it prosperous and thrive once more. As such, it should be a no-brainer that our region participates in what is expected to be the next big tech-based boom – gaming. This article looks at why gaming as an industry would be the perfect fit for the Space Coast. 

The Gaming Industry

The gaming industry in the US is by far the fastest growing business opportunity that there is at the moment. There are over 2.7 billion gamers worldwide and 75% of US households have at least one person who could be regarded as a core gamer. The global gaming market is huge and is expected to reach $314 billion by 2026. The next big thing is going to be in next-generation console design and development, as well as virtual reality gaming. It’s big money, and an industry that’s always on the lookout for, skilled techies, opportunities, and improved ways of innovating and developing their products.
